I'm not tied to a specific handgun for carry, but I think it's most important to try to carry in the same type of holster, with the same cant, worn in the same place (and be practiced with one's drawstroke) as often as possible ... Hence, all my holsters for each handgun I may carry, are the same type of OWB or IWB.
Also, I may vary my carry gun, but I generally stick with similar platforms and keep aware of what I'm carrying.
